A surgical algorithm using open rhinoplasty for correction of traumatic twisted nose

Summary
This study details open rhinoplasty for correcting traumatic twisted noses in Asian patients. The proposed surgical algorithm offers effective and satisfactory functional and aesthetic outcomes.
Area of Science:
- Plastic Surgery
- Otorhinolaryngology
- Facial Reconstruction
Background:
- Traumatic twisted nose deformities present unique challenges in Asian populations.
- Correction often requires tailored surgical approaches to address aesthetic and functional deficits.
Purpose of the Study:
- To present an experience with open rhinoplasty for traumatic twisted nose correction in Asian patients.
- To introduce and evaluate a standardized surgical algorithm for managing these deformities.
Main Methods:
- Retrospective chart review of 92 Asian patients with traumatic twisted nose treated between 2001 and 2004.
- Open rhinoplasty performed under general anesthesia.
- Postoperative functional and aesthetic outcomes assessed via patient self-evaluation surveys.
Main Results:
- All 92 patients (87 males, 5 females; age 15-53 years) underwent successful open rhinoplasty with no intraoperative or postoperative complications.
- Patient self-evaluations indicated significant improvements in nasal function.
- High satisfaction rates with both functional and aesthetic results were reported.
Conclusions:
- Open rhinoplasty, guided by a structured surgical algorithm, is an effective method for correcting traumatic twisted nose deformities in Asian individuals.
- The proposed algorithm provides a adaptable framework for achieving consistent, satisfactory functional and aesthetic results.
- This approach offers a reliable solution for improving patient quality of life after nasal trauma.
